Boston Harbor is an unincorporated community in Thurston County, Washington. The community is home to the Dofflemyer Point Light , built in 1934 and list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1995.

The Olympia area's station on Amtrak's Coast Starlight line was located in East Olympia before it moved to Lacey in 1994. [2] Rural lands immediately southeast of the community were under consideration, beginning in 2022, for a proposed new airport to "help meet commercial and cargo demand" for Washington state. [3] [4]
